Cleaning Agent: TUN Solve® cleaning agent solves decadelong safety problem! +++ Video +++

March 01, 2007, 07:25 AM

Innovation on the market: only TUN Solve® complies with safety cleaning agent requirements which have previously been impossible to meet in the practical workshop situation:

  • Optimal A1 cleaning performance and
  • Tested and reduced fire risk.

Your Company's "safety belt": TUN Solve® is the outcome of intensive collaboration between the Accident Prevention and Insurance Association Safety Committees, the GermanPhysikalisch-Technische Bundesanstalt, TÜV South and TUNAP. With TUN Solve® you are in compliance with current Ordinance on Hazardous Substances (fire) risk minimisation requirements.

Advantages of the TUN Solve® innovation over your previous cleaner:

  • Technical quality and cleaning performance:
  • Removes dust, incrustations, oil, grease, resin, silicons and rust protection coatings
  • Good drying performance
  • Dissipates electrostatic charge

 

Hazard potential:

  • Cleaner provides lowest level of hazard (complies with Accident Prevention Ordinance)

 

Reduces risk of fire and consequences of fire:

  • Low-speed detonation
  • No afterburn
  • No flame blowback

 

Explosion hazard:

  • Low explosion threshold > 1.5 vol %
  • Ignition temperature > 700° C

 

Hazard Class:

  • Non-combustible accelerant (no F+ coding)

 

Health and Safety at Work Protection:

  • Formulation independently tested and monitored by TÜV South
  • Low n-hexane content, no aromatics

 

Environmental Protection Effect:

  • Reduced CO2 emission
  • Toxicologically tested ingredient content
  • No N-Classification

 

Legal Safety:

  • Cleaner represents latest state of the art
  • Complies with substitution ban (in accordance with Hazardous Substances Ordinance) = product selectionby risk analysis.
